2. How do you smoke cannabis flower?
When it comes to cannabis flower consumption, smoking is the most preferred way. The effects are immediate and often last one to three hours, depending on dose and individual tolerance. There are 4 main methods for smoking cannabis flower:
1. Joint: A joint is created by rolling ground flower in smokable rolling paper (), much like a cigarette.
2. Blunts: Blunts include wrapping ground flower in a cigar wrap or an empty cigar to provide a unique smoking experience.
3. Pipe: Pipes are popular among cannabis smokers because they provide a portable alternative without the need for extra materials. Simply fill the pipe with flower, light it, and take a puff.
4. Water pipe, commonly known as a bong, allows users to filter smoke through water, resulting in a smoother and cooler effect. It’s a popular option for people looking for a more refined smoking experience.

5. Why are they called Marijuana flowers instead of just Marijuana?
Cannabis flower language has evolved throughout time. The process of a male plant pollinating a female plant was once referred to as “flowering,” but this term is no longer used. The buds we smoke are included in the contemporary definition of a flower, regardless of whether they generate seeds. Female and male plants both have flowers, with females generating resin-coated calyxes and men producing seeds. The phrase “flowering” or “blooming” refers to the final six to ten weeks of the growth period.
With the legalization of marijuana, the definitions of “marijuana” and “marijuana product” have broadened. Going to a dispensary now provides more alternatives than just standard buds, like edibles, hash, topicals, and more. Buds are usually referred to as “flower” in the business and by readers to prevent misunderstanding.

How Do I Assess the Quality of Cannabis Flowers?
To assess the quality of cannabis flowers, follow these steps:
1. Aroma: High-quality buds have a strong, distinct scent, indicating the presence of trichomes and terpenes. Weak smells suggest lower quality.
2. Structure: Consider the shape, trim, color, and hairs of the bud. Indica buds are dense, while sativa buds are more open. Look for intact, evenly sized buds.
3. Trichomes: These crystal-like structures contain cannabinoids and terpenes. Buds with a thick layer of pearly white trichomes are typically of higher quality.
4. Texture and Moisture Content: Quality buds feel soft, plump, and springy, with a slight stickiness. Avoid dry or overly wet buds.
5. Genetics and THC Percentage: Consider the strain’s genetic lineage, terpene profile, and THC percentage to gauge its overall quality and effects.
By following these steps, you can effectively evaluate and select high-quality cannabis flowers.
